**First-day checklist — turnstile upgrade (Facilities)**

☐ Heads up: the lobby turnstiles at Corvin Plaza got swapped over the weekend, and the new Gatewick readers are fussy — badges need a flat tap, not a wave. New starters won't be in the badge system until midday, so walk them through the accessible gate instead. Log each manual entry in the day book so security doesn't chase us. Until their badges sync, have them key in the code below.

badge for fafop-fajof: bdg-Z-47

Subject: On-call notes for the parcel-tracking webhook

Welcome aboard. The Trundlepost parcel-tracking webhook is our noisiest integration: carriers retry aggressively, so duplicate delivery events are expected and deduplicated downstream. Support tickets usually involve missing scan events, which almost always trace back to an expired carrier subscription rather than our ingest. Before escalating, verify the subscription status and check the last successful heartbeat. The full triage runbook lives on the internal page below.

wiki page, tahaf-tajog: https://jira.ordindyn.corp/pipeline

Plugins built against the Cartwheel Commerce API must never hard-delete rows in `orders`. Instead, set `deleted_at` via the `/orders/{id}/retire` endpoint, which preserves referential integrity for refunds and audit exports. Rows with a non-null `deleted_at` are excluded from all default queries; pass `include_retired=true` to see them. Purging happens nightly via the Sweeper job, thirty days after retirement. All retire calls go through the internal Ledgerline service, which authenticates with the key below.

service key, faduf-tagep: vxb4-nWCH

MEMO — Quarterly Stock-Count Ledger Transfer

To the warehouse shift lead: the completed Q3 ledger for the Dunmere depot must be sealed in the blue document wallet, with both count sheets and the variance summary enclosed. Verify page numbering before sealing. Ashvale Couriers collects at 14:00 Friday. At collection, give the courier the instruction stated immediately below.

handover note for yagef-bagep: the drudor pelius courier leaves the kasdor zorvan norir ledger at gate 8016 under passcode 755406